Manager Software Engineering

Not Interested
Bookmark
Report This Job

profile Job Location:

Philadelphia, PA - USA

profile Monthly Salary: Not Disclosed
Posted on: Yesterday
Vacancies: 1 Vacancy

Job Summary

Job Details

Manager Software Engineering

Job Description

The Manager Software Engineering is a hands-on leader who actively participates in the architecture design and development of scalable efficient and secure technology addition to managing people projects and processes the Manager works closely with engineering teams contributing technical expertise reviewing code and guiding best practices throughout the software development lifecycle. This role ensures that development efforts align with business objectives and drive innovation while also serving as a bridge between business stakeholders and technical teams. By translating requirements into actionable plans and fostering a collaborative high-performance engineering culture the Manager empowers teams to deliver impactful solutions and continuously improve technical outcomes.

Key Responsibilities

Strategic Planning & Leadership

  • Align software engineering initiatives with business goals and strategic objectives.

  • Drive application rationalization consolidation integration and optimization across platforms such as ServiceNow Salesforce enterprise web (Adobe/Drupal) Enterprise Intranet (Unily) MuleSoft APIs Kyruss & Credential Stream Azure Cloud and other custom and third-party applications.

  • Evaluate and integrate cutting-edge technologies drive innovation and continuous improvement and ensure smooth transitions during modernization efforts.

  • Minimize downtime and maximize benefits of modernization.

Architecture and Design

  • Work with architects and technical leads and oversee and contribute to the enhancement and creation of scalable efficient and secure platforms and solutions including ServiceNow consolidation Salesforce adoption AEM and Drupal consolidation MuleSoft integration and Azure Cloud utilization.

  • Ensure cohesive integration and optimal performance across all platforms.

Software Development Oversight

  • Work with architects and technical leads and guide teams and contribute to architecture design coding testing and deployment of software and infrastructure solutions.

  • Address and resolve system issues for optimal functionality.

Security and Risk Management

  • Collaborate with security teams architects technical leads in risk assessment and mitigation.

  • Guide software engineering teams in creating secure solutions and following best practices.

  • Enhance system performance and security reduce vulnerabilities and improve overall system reliability.

DevOps & CI/CD

  • Demonstrate expertise in DevOps practices and continuous integration/deployment.

  • Streamline processes to ensure efficient and error-free deployments improving development cycles and operational efficiency.

Team Management & Mentorship

  • Lead mentor and develop software engineering teams fostering growth and technical excellence.

  • Provide technical guidance and mentorship to enhance skills and knowledge.

  • Guide teams in adopting best practices for software development DevOps CI/CD and agile methodologies.

Collaboration & Stakeholder Engagement

  • Act as a bridge between Product Management Marketing and other stakeholders and technical teams.

  • Translate business requirements into technical solutions.

  • Ensure seamless integration and collaboration across merged entities.

Continuous Learning

  • Stay up to date with the latest technologies and industry trends.

  • Promote a culture of innovation learning and continuous improvement within engineering teams.

Documentation

  • Create and guide teams in maintaining proper documentation adhering to agile practices.

  • Ensure organized code repositories.

Operational Excellence & On-Call Support

  • Oversee incident management and on-call support for production systems applications infrastructure and platforms.

  • Implement emergency fixes and provide root cause analysis for incidents.

Vendor Engagement & New Initiatives

  • Engage with multiple vendors on new initiatives including Salesforce Adobe AEM EPIC and ServiceNow.

  • Ensure new initiatives are aligned with organizational goals and technical requirements.

Skills & Requirements

  • Bachelors degree in Computer Science Engineering or related field (or equivalent experience).

  • 10 years of expertise in software engineering and development with at least 5 years in leadership or management roles.

  • Strong technical background in programming languages (Java JavaScript Python etc.) cloud platforms DevOps CI/CD automation and microservices.

  • Strong knowledge and work experience in configuration management and solutions deployment automation.

  • Strong work experience designing and delivering scalable secure and resilient systems.

  • Proven ability to lead and mentor engineering teams manage projects and drive results.

  • Strong work experience in software and cloud infrastructure security best practices including secure authentication encryption zero trust architecture and compliance.

  • Good work experience with containerization and orchestration (Docker Docker Swarm Kubernetes) building and deploying enterprise applications on containers and provisioning orchestration infrastructure on the cloud.

  • Good work experience with Disaster Recovery and High Availability designing systems for high availability and disaster recovery ensuring minimal downtime and data loss.

  • Strong work experience managing and designing databases including SQL and NoSQL databases.

  • Strong work experience building distributed secure and scalable software solutions in Spring Boot Java and ORM solutions.

  • Strong work experience in Version Control using Git.

  • Strong work experience in CI/CD tools like Azure DevOps Jenkins and GitLab CI/CD.

  • Strong work experience with monitoring and logging best practices tools like ELK Stack (Elasticsearch Logstash Kibana) and Splunk.

  • Excellent communication collaboration and stakeholder management skills.

  • agement skills.

Work Shift

Workday Day (United States of America)

Worker Sub Type

Regular

Employee Entity

Thomas Jefferson University

Primary Location Address

833 Chestnut Street Philadelphia Pennsylvania United States of America

Nationally ranked Jefferson which is principally located in the greater Philadelphia region Lehigh Valley and Northeastern Pennsylvania and southern New Jersey is reimagining health care and higher education to create unparalleled value. Jefferson is more than 65000 people strong dedicated to providing the highest-quality compassionate clinical care for patients; making our communities healthier and stronger; preparing tomorrows professional leaders for 21st-century careers; and creating new knowledge through basic/programmatic clinical and applied research. Thomas Jefferson University home of Sidney Kimmel Medical College Jefferson College of Nursing and the Kanbar College of Design Engineering and Commerce dates back to 1824 and today comprises 10 colleges and three schools offering 200 undergraduate and graduate programs to more than 8300 students. Jefferson Health nationally ranked as one of the top 15 not-for-profit health care systems in the country and the largest provider in the Philadelphia and Lehigh Valley areas serves patients through millions of encounters each year at 32 hospitals campuses and more than 700 outpatient and urgent care locations throughout the region. Jefferson Health Plans is a not-for-profit managed health care organization providing a broad range of health coverage options in Pennsylvania and New Jersey for more than 35 years.

Jefferson is committed to providing equal educational and employment opportunities for all persons without regard to age race color religion creed sexual orientation gender gender identity marital status pregnancy national origin ancestry citizenship military status veteran status handicap or disability or any other protected group or status.

Benefits

Jefferson offers a comprehensive package of benefits for full-time and part-time colleagues including medical (including prescription) supplemental insurance dental vision life and AD&D insurance short- and long-term disability flexible spending accounts retirement plans tuition assistance as well as voluntary benefits which provide colleagues with access to group rates on insurance and discounts. Colleagues have access to tuition discounts at Thomas Jefferson University after one year of full time service or two years of part time service. All colleagues including those who work less than part-time(including per diemcolleagues adjunct faculty and Jeff Temps) have access to medical (including prescription) insurance.

For more benefits information please click here


Required Experience:

Manager

Job DetailsManager Software EngineeringJob DescriptionThe Manager Software Engineering is a hands-on leader who actively participates in the architecture design and development of scalable efficient and secure technology addition to managing people projects and processes the Manager works closely w...
View more view more

Key Skills

  • Hospitality Experience
  • Go
  • Management Experience
  • React
  • Redux
  • Node.js
  • AWS
  • Mechanical Engineering
  • Team Management
  • Leadership Experience
  • Mentoring
  • Distributed Systems

About Company

Company Logo

At Thomas Jefferson University in Philadelphia, PA, we are helping you to redefine what’s possible with innovative and tailored education opportunities.

View Profile View Profile